ICYMI: Michigan Energy Hikes Among Highest in Nation

Lansing, MI – Over the weekend, The Detroit News published a comprehensive report on Michigan’s skyrocketing energy costs. Here are just some of the highlights:

  • Over the last 20 years, Michigan’s energy rates have increased faster than 46 other states’.

  • Homeowners today are expected to pay $850 more per year than in 2006.

  • Over the last five years, Governor Gretchen Whitmer’s Public Service Commission (MPSC) has approved $1 billion in electricity rate hikes alone.
